This Parisian Hot Chocolate is a thick and creamy French hot chocolate, made with ingredients such as rich, dark unsweetened chocolate, Dutch processed cocoa and heavy cream, and a touch of Lakanto monk fruit sweetener. This keto hot chocolate recipe is for true chocolate lovers! We spent six days in Paris and fell in love with the tasty, dessert like, hot cocoa which we savoured at the world famous Café Angelina. A tres leches cake is light, moist sponge cake, soaked in a mixture of three kinds of milk, hence the name tres leches. This keto cake has three layers, the keto vanilla sponge cake, the tres leches and it is topped with a generous layer of Chantilly cream stabilized with mascarpone. The tres leches keto recipe uses almond milk, heavy cream, and my sugar free sweetened condensed milk recipe . The Keto Tres Leches Cake is an easy keto vanilla sponge cake to make, and is a great make ahead low carb cake, because the flavour develops even more over a couple of days.
